Friday Reading, Saturday Leeds always tends to be the first time or smaller headliner that is one for the future (Dave, Stormzy, 1975, Fallout Boy, Kasabian, Foals, Mumford) Paramore

Saturday Reading, Sunday Leeds always tends to be the huge name draw that everybody is going to watch, they can get a day ticket and have the Saturday/Sunday party without work the next day (Post Malone, Kendrick Lamar, Eminem, Arctic Monkeys, Killers, RHCP) Travis Scott

Sunday Reading, Friday Leeds always tends to be the historic name that represents what R&L has always been, gets the old goers amped up to finish the festival with nostalgia (Muse, Kings of Leon, Foo Fighters, Rage Against the Machine) Blink-182
